The axially loaded bar ABCD is held between rigid supports as shown below. The bar has cross-sectional area A1 = 1 in2 from A to C and 2A1 = 2 in2 from C to D and is subjected to an axial force P = 50 kips as shown.

Determine (a) the reactions at A and (b) displacement at point C if the modulus of Elasticity E = 30 x 106 psi and L = 8 ft.
